Ranked #21 in popularity, nursing administration is one of the most sought-after master's degree programs in the nation. This makes choosing the right school a hard decision.

College Factual looked at 10 colleges and universities when compiling its 2024 Best Nursing Administration Master's Degree Schools in the Plains States Region ranking. When you put them all together, these colleges and universities awarded 615 master's degrees in nursing administration during the 2020-2021 academic year.

Quality Overall Is Important

A school that excels in educating for a particular major and degree level must be a great school overall as well. To make it into this list a school must rank well in our overall Best Colleges for a Master's Degree ranking. This ranking considered factors such as graduation rates, overall graduate earnings and other educational resources to identify great colleges and universities.
